Dmitri Mendeleev was a Russian scientist who is best known for his work on the periodic table of elements. In the mid-1800s, chemists had discovered and isolated a number of elements, but they struggled to understand the relationships between them. Mendeleev sought to solve this problem by organizing the elements based on their atomic weights and other properties.
Mendeleev's periodic table was a revolutionary concept that greatly advanced the field of chemistry. It allowed chemists to predict the properties of new elements based on their position in the table, and it helped to explain why certain elements behaved in certain ways. The periodic table also helped to clarify the relationships between elements, making it easier for scientists to understand the chemical reactions that occurred between them.
One of the most impressive aspects of Mendeleev's work was that he was able to predict the existence and properties of elements that had not yet been discovered. For example, he predicted the existence of several elements that were later discovered and found to have properties that matched his predictions. This showed the power of his periodic table as a tool for understanding the elements and their relationships.
Mendeleev's periodic table has undergone several updates and revisions over the years, but it remains a cornerstone of chemistry and a testament to the genius of Dmitri Mendeleev. His work has had a profound impact on the field of chemistry and has helped to advance our understanding of the building blocks of matter. Overall, Dmitri Mendeleev's work on the periodic table has made him one of the most important figures in the history of chemistry and his legacy continues to shape our understanding of the world around us.
